A dirt bike trailer mount is a device that allows you to transport your dirt bike securely and conveniently on a trailer. It is designed to securely hold your dirt bike in place, preventing it from moving during transit.
If you often travel to different riding locations or participate in dirt bike competitions, a dirt bike trailer mount is essential. It ensures the safe transportation of your bike, preventing any damage that could occur if it's not properly secured.
A dirt bike trailer mount typically consists of a front wheel chock and tie-down straps. The front wheel chock holds the front wheel of your bike in place, while the tie-down straps secure the bike to the trailer. This combination effectively prevents the bike from moving or tipping over during travel.
